#711d98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#711d98 is composed of 44.3% red, 11.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25.7% cyan, 80.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 281 degrees, a saturation of 68% and a lightness of 35.5%. #711d98 color hex could be obtained by blending #e23aff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#711d98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030104 is the darkest color, while #f9f2f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#711d98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5d5560 is the less saturated color, while #7b01b4 is the most saturated one.
